Safety checkpoints for buying a used utility trailer

Before completing a utility trailer bill of sale in Delaware, verify these safety items:

  • Check tongue weight and coupler size compatibility with tow vehicle
  • Inspect all lighting connections and ground wire
  • Verify axle rating matches loaded weight capacity needs
  • Test surge or electric brakes if GVWR exceeds 3,000 lbs

Utility Trailer insurance and depreciation in Delaware

Optional unless financed. Liability often covered under tow vehicle policy. Standalone coverage: $100–$250/year. Steel utility trailers hold value extremely well — 70–85% retention over 10 years. Peak season for private utility trailer sales is spring through summer for landscaping and home projects, with an average of 12 days on market.

Utility Trailer registration and titling

Utility Trailers are classified as "Utility trailer (weight-class dependent titling)" for registration purposes. Many states exempt trailers under 2,000–3,000 lbs from titling. Check your state threshold. Federal odometer disclosure does not apply to utility trailers.
